Brian, Amadeus has been permitting "manual" markers for
ages. I do manual all the time because I'm a control freak.

Besides, a lot of "classical" stuff has moments of silence that
I hardly ever want to break on.

Position the cursor in the light gray band above the darker gray
band (with track name, volume, playback, etc). Click it. A marker
will appear. You can move the marker or delete it or rename it.
Once you select sound/split acccording to markers, Amadeus will
save the "split" file into a folder of tracks named according to the
marker names in an audio format you like.

Try it.

Good idea.
One of my favourites is copy or cut a part and then "Paste to new track" The new part can be moved anywhere in the timeline. I also like to use lots of markers as temporary guidelines.
